GS8591/GS8592/GS8594放大器是单//四电源,微功耗,零漂移CMOS算放大器,这些放大器提供4.5MHz的带宽,轨至轨输入和输出以及1.8V5.5V的单电源供电GS859X使用斩波稳定技术来提供非常低的失调电压(最大值小于50µV),并且在整个温度范围内漂移接近零。每个放大器550µA低静态电源电流和20pA的极低输入偏置电流使这些器件成为低失调,低功耗和高阻抗应用的理想选择。GS859X提供了出色的CMRR,而没有与传统的互补输入级相关的分频器。这种设计在驱动模数转换器(ADC)方面具有卓越的性能,而不会降低差分线性度。GS8591提供SOT23-5SOP-8封装。GS8592提供MSOP-8SOP-8封装。GS8594Quad具有绿色SOP-14TSSOP-14封装。在所有电源电压下,-45oC+125oC的扩展温度范围提供了额外的设计灵活性。特性:+1.8V+5.5V单电源供电•嵌入式RFEMI滤波器•轨到轨输入/输出•小型封装:•增益带宽乘积:4.5MHz(典型@25°CGS8591采用SOT23-5SOP-8封装•低输入偏置电流:20pA(典型值@25°CGS8592采用MSOP-8SOP-8•低失调电压:30µV(最大@25°CGS8594采用SOP-14TSSOP-14封装•静态电流:每个放大器550µA(典型值)•工作温度:-45°C+125°C•零漂移:0.03µV/oC(典型值)
